Scuba Diving Math Worksheet
Scuba Diving Math Worksheet

Scuba Diving Math Worksheet

Let your student explore the ocean depths with this vibrant PDF worksheet. Have them count the sea creatures they see and select the correct graph to represent their findings. Combining pictograms and bar graphs, they'll have loads of fun discovering what lies beneath!

Tree Graph Worksheet
Tree Graph Worksheet

Tree Graph Worksheet

Help your child/students learn to read graphs and report data. With this colorful worksheet, the different types of trees in a school's garden are listed in a bar graph. Guide them through viewing it and answering the questions. To extend the lesson, have them create a tree graph to list the trees at their own school or home.

Patterns in Temperature Worksheet
Patterns in Temperature Worksheet

Patterns in Temperature Worksheet

Kids need to learn how to read and interpret data from graphs and charts. This free worksheet on temperature patterns helps them to do just that. They'll practice finding averages and answer questions in multiple-choice format. Plus, it provides a great learning experience!
